我正在尝试使用从 iPhone 导入选项,如 WWDC 会话中所示。
https://developer.apple.com/wwdc21/10289
我添加了代码
WindowGroup {
ContentView()
.environment(\.managedObjectContext, persistenceController.container.viewContext)
}
.commands {
ImportFromDevicesCommands()
}
ContentView.swift 是
List {
ForEach(items) { item in
NavigationLink {
Text("Item at \(item.timestamp!, formatter: itemFormatter)")
} label: {
Text(item.timestamp!, formatter: itemFormatter)
}
}
.onDelete(perform: deleteItems)
}
.importsItemProviders([.image,.png,.jpeg,.rawImage], onImport: { providers in
print("checking reachability")
return true
})
importItemProviders 块本身没有被执行,也没有打印任何东西。
另外我收到警报操作无法完成。(可可错误 66563。)
有什么可以让这个功能正常工作的吗?